## Deployment

ReceiptWren, our donation-receipt mailer, deploys from the `stable` branch via the Quillgate pipeline. Before promoting a build, confirm the template bundle version matches what the Harbrook finance team signed off on, since receipts are legally sensitive. Run the dry-run mailer against the sandbox donor list and inspect at least three rendered PDFs. Rollbacks must restore both the binary and the template bundle together; mismatched pairs produce blank totals. The environment expects the following configuration values at startup.

settings of tawif-tafog:
[oliox]
port = 7000
team = pelius
host = oliox.plorvaforge.corp
region = upper-2
access_code = ac_48b9f0
timeout_ms = 3000

Memo — Uniforms, Garrowby Depot

Coordinator: the uniform shipment for the new Garrowby Depot is packed and staged at dock 2. Assign one driver, single run, no intermediate stops. Sizes were verified against the staffing list; shortfalls go on back-order next week.

The confidential courier hand-over instruction is appended immediately below.

courier memo of tawep-tajep: the quenius ulaiel courier leaves the fenir ledger at gate 9128 under passcode 527513

## Formula sandbox tuning

User-supplied formulas in Gridmoor execute inside a restricted interpreter with hard ceilings on time, memory, and call depth. Reviewers should confirm any change to these ceilings is justified in the PR description, since raising them widens the abuse surface. Defaults were chosen from production traces. The current limits are as follows.

limits module of tafog-fawip:
WEIGHTS = {
    "julix": 57,
    "lamys": 992,
    "kasvan": 209,
    "quenok": 750,
    "alddor": 259,
    "oliath": 1009,
    "wenix": 815,
}